Jackson Ultima ProFlex Boot System
The Jackson Ultima ProFlex Boot is a hinged boot that is designed to reduce joint injuries. It allows competitive skaters to flex their ankles and cushion their landings. With the hinged design, a skater can land with his or her heel high in the air, increasing the landing time and resulting in a lot less stress on the knees, hips and spine.
